Controlling Your Inner Trader: A Guide to Emotional Mastery

The financial markets can be a rollercoaster ride, triggering intense emotions that can lead to impulsive decisions and wasted opportunities. Thriving in this volatile environment requires more than just technical expertise; it demands emotional intelligence and disciplined trading strategies. By adopting proven techniques for emotional regulation, you can transform your inner trader and navigate the markets with confidence.

  • Begin by recognizing your emotional triggers. Typical culprits include fear, greed, impatience, and overconfidence. Once you understand what excites these responses, you can develop strategies to manage their impact.
  • Cultivate a pre-trade routine that helps you focus yourself before entering any position. This could involve deep breathing exercises, meditation, or simply taking a few moments to analyze your trading plan.
  • Establish realistic expectations and avoid chasing quick profits. Remember that trading is a marathon, not a sprint. Be persistent and focus on building a profitable track record over time.

Keep in mind that losses are an inevitable part of trading. View them as learning opportunities rather than personal failures. By examining your mistakes, you can pinpoint areas for improvement and strengthen your trading commitment.

Cultivating Mental Strength in Trading

In the volatile realm of trading, where emotions can dictate your every move, cultivating mental fortitude is paramount. A resilient mindset allows you to navigate market fluctuations with grace, making calculated decisions even under pressure. To forge an unyielding spirit, consider these exercises:

  • Visualization: Envision yourself confidently executing trades, remaining calm amidst market turmoil.
  • Journaling: Document your trading experiences, analyzing both successes and failures to glean valuable insights.
  • Stress Reduction Techniques: Practice mindfulness techniques to center yourself, fostering focus in the present moment.

By consistently engaging in these exercises, you can strengthen your mental fortitude, enabling you to trade with unwavering composure and achieve lasting check here success.
